Go to https://developers.facebook.com Create new app Go to Dashboard Add product Select Facebook login Go to Client OAuth Settings Client OAuth Login = YES Web OAuth Login = YES Go to Facebook Login -> Quick Start -> iOS Download SDK OR Go to below link https://origincache.facebook.com/developers/resources/?id=facebook-ios-sdk-current.zip Go to in your Xcode Project add below four framework […]
CollectionViewManager.h #import <Foundation/Foundation.h> #import “CollectionViewFlowLayout.h” #import “CollectionViewCell.h” #import “Constant.h” typedef void (^DidTapOnCollectionViewCell)(NSInteger IndexpathRow, NSString *imageURL); //typedef void (^DidTapOnCloseButton) (NSString *str); @interface CollectionViewManager : NSObject<UICollectionViewDataSource,UICollectionViewDelegate,CellDelegate> { CGRect aFrame; NSIndexPath *aIndexPath; } @property (nonatomic, retain) UICollectionView *collectionView; @property (nonatomic, retain) NSMutableArray *arrMain; @property (nonatomic, copy) DidTapOnCollectionViewCell didTapOnCollectionViewCell; //@property (nonatomic, copy) DidTapOnCloseButton didTapOnCloseButton; -(id)initwithCollectionView:(UICollectionView […]
Reference From :: ZJSwitch ViewController.h #import <UIKit/UIKit.h> #import “ZJSwitch.h” @interface ViewController : UIViewController @property (weak, nonatomic) IBOutlet UIView *viewForSwitchFirst; @property (weak, nonatomic) IBOutlet UIView *viewForSwitchTwo; @property (weak, nonatomic) IBOutlet UISwitch *SwitchOnOff; – (IBAction)switchActionOnOff:(id)sender; @end ViewController.m #import “ViewController.h” @interface ViewController () @end @implementation ViewController – (void)viewDidLoad { [super viewDidLoad]; // […]
ViewController.h #import <UIKit/UIKit.h> #import “SingletonClass.h” @interface ViewController : UIViewController @end ViewController.m #import “ViewController.h” @interface ViewController () @end @implementation ViewController – (void)viewDidLoad { [super viewDidLoad]; NSString *stringFirst = @”First”; NSString *stringSecond = @”Second”; NSString *stringConcatenated; stringConcatenated = [[SingletonClass sharedSingletonClass]twoStringConcatenationFirstString:stringFirst SeconString:stringSecond]; NSLog(@”%@”,stringConcatenated); […]
– (void)viewDidLoad { [super viewDidLoad]; [[NSNotificationCenter defaultCenter] addObserver:self selector:@selector(keyboardWillShow:) name:UIKeyboardWillShowNotification object:nil]; [[NSNotificationCenter defaultCenter] addObserver:self selector:@selector(keyboardWillHide:) name:UIKeyboardWillHideNotification object:nil]; UITapGestureRecognizer *aGest = [[UITapGestureRecognizer alloc] initWithTarget:self action:@selector(tapDetected)]; aGest.numberOfTapsRequired = 1; [self.ScrlViewSignUpVC addGestureRecognizer:aGest]; // Do any additional setup after […]
ViewController.h #import <UIKit/UIKit.h> #import “NewViewController.h” #import “UserDetailDataModel.h” @interface ViewController : UIViewController<UITextFieldDelegate> @property (weak, nonatomic) IBOutlet UITextField *textFieldCurrent; @property (weak, nonatomic) IBOutlet UITextField *textFieldFirstName; @property (weak, nonatomic) IBOutlet UITextField *textFieldLastName; @property (weak, nonatomic) IBOutlet UITextField *textFieldPhoneNumber; @property (weak, nonatomic) IBOutlet UITextField *textFieldCity; @property (weak, nonatomic) IBOutlet UIScrollView *scrollViewSignUp; – (IBAction)buttonActionSubmit:(id)sender; – (IBAction)buttonActionCancel:(id)sender; @end ViewController.m #import “ViewController.h” […]
#import “ViewController.h” @interface ViewController () @property (strong, nonatomic) NSMutableArray *names, *populations; @end @implementation ViewController – (void)viewDidLoad { [super viewDidLoad]; NSString *filePath = [[NSBundle mainBundle] pathForResource:@”Cities” ofType:@”plist”]; NSData *data = [NSData dataWithContentsOfFile:filePath]; NSPropertyListFormat format; NSString *error; id fileContents = [NSPropertyListSerialization propertyListFromData:data mutabilityOption:NSPropertyListImmutable […]
ViewController.h #import <UIKit/UIKit.h> #define kPadding 20 @interface ViewController : UIViewController { CGSize _pageSize; } – (IBAction)btnCreatePDFPress:(id)sender; @end ViewController.m #import “ViewController.h” @interface ViewController () @end @implementation ViewController – (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the view, […]
– (IBAction)btnGeneratePDFPress:(id)sender { [self createPDFfromUIView:self.view saveToDocumentsWithFileName:@”NewPDF.pdf”]; } -(void)createPDFfromUIView:(UIView*)aView saveToDocumentsWithFileName:(NSString*)aFilename { // Creates a mutable data object for updating with binary data, like a byte array NSMutableData *pdfData = [NSMutableData data]; // Points the pdf converter to the mutable data object […]
FPProductListViewController.h #import <UIKit/UIKit.h> #import “FPProductDetailViewController.h” #import “FPCartViewController.h” @interface FPProductListViewController : UIViewController<UITableViewDataSource,UITableViewDelegate> { NSArray *arysampleData; } @property (strong, nonatomic) NSMutableDictionary *dicProductDetailFrmProdctLst; @property (strong, nonatomic) NSMutableArray *arySelectedProductsFrmPrdctLst; @property (strong, nonatomic) NSArray *aryTableData; @property (strong, nonatomic) IBOutlet UITableView *tblVwProductList; – (IBAction)btnBackClicked:(id)sender; – (IBAction)btnCartClicked:(id)sender; @end FPProductListViewController.m #import “FPProductListViewController.h” @interface FPProductListViewController () @end @implementation FPProductListViewController – (void)viewDidLoad { […]